Matthew Carroll

Matthew Carroll

Dean of Students, History, Head Coach - Boys Soccer, Head Coach - Girls Soccer

Matthew graduated from the Brooks School in Massachusetts, after attending the Delbarton School in New Jersey. At Brooks, Matthew was the captain of the soccer team and was selected to the All-New England team. During these years, Matthew also lettered in wrestling and lacrosse. During his high school years, Matthew was a member of the U.S. Regional and National Pool teams.

Matthew graduated from Dartmouth College in 2009, majoring in Government with a minor in Sociology. He was a member of the Dartmouth men’s soccer team, where he was named an All-Ivy selection during his junior year and was Captain during his senior year. During this year he was also the player-coach of the team. Matthew was awarded the Norman Grant Clark award, which embodies “contributions to Dartmouth soccer both on and off the field.”

After his graduation from Dartmouth, Matthew spent his first two years teaching History and working in Admissions at St. Andrew’s and subsequently worked as a Human Capital Consultant at Mercer in New York City.

Matthew lives on Baum corridor with his wife, Jenny, and their sons, Finn and Jack, and their daughter, Teagan.
